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This report contains data on state funding for higher education for the 1997-1998 school year. State funding for higher education continued to grow in FY98 for the fifth straight year, increasing 6%, or $2.8 billion, over the prior fiscal year. The amount of support for higher education exceeded $49 billion, and the 1-year and 2-year percentage gains were the largest since 1990 and were nearly enough to make up for the recession of the early 1990s. Only four states (Alaska, Hawaii, New Mexico, and Tennessee) reduced their general funding appropriations for higher education from the previous year, and their cuts were rather small. Appropriations grew in every other states except Wyoming, where state funding remained flat. Although higher education fared well financially during this fiscal year, there continued to be a fundamental anxiety about higher education, resulting in a number of proposed or enacted restrictions and accountability measures for higher education. The report contains a discussion of higher education appropriates and national trends, followed by national tables and some comparative measures. A third section discusses state-by-state appropriations. (Contains 3 figures, 15 tables, and 17 references.) (SLD)

Book excerpt: This report explains that the General Fund budget: (1) calls for $1,565.4 million for the FY 2009-11 biennium, including $781.2 million in FY 2010 and $784.2 million in FY 2011; and (2) maintains the State's primary student financial aid programs at FY 2009 funding levels, with Connecticut Aid to Charter Oak funded at 80.0 percent of full funding and the Connecticut Independent College Student Grant program (CICSG) along with the Connecticut Aid to Public college Students grant (CAPCS) at 80.5 percent and 55.0 percent of full funding, respectively. The Appropriations Committee recommends maintaining a separate Department of Higher Education. Funding for the University of Connecticut, Connecticut State University, the Connecticut Community College System and Charter Oak State College represents the restoration of 2009 rescissions. At the UConn Health Center, recommendations include additional funding of $10 million to recognize anticipated fringe benefit costs and $500,000 to continue funding for the Connecticut Health Information Network, an initiation which integrates state health and social services data within and across the Health Center, the Office of Health Care Access and the Departments of Public Health, Mental Retardation and Children and Families.
